I know drafting a kicker early is taboo, but shout out to Brandon Aubrey by [deleted] in fantasyfootball

[–]TheNotoriousMAZ 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I understand doing away with kickers. Their performance can be tied to some increasingly dubious coaching decisions and other randomness.

Defenses come down to matchups, health etc. just like other positions. I think most people’s issues with team defenses stem from how they are scored in most platforms. Sometimes a defense has a truly amazing performance in reality (holds a team to under 14 points and low yardage), and they don’t get rewarded for it in fantasy just because they didn’t get a lot of sacks and turnovers. On the flip side, you often see a terrible defensive performance in reality get rewarded in fantasy just because they got a pick 6 at one point.

1200 Mile Summer Tire Review: General G-Max RS by TheNotoriousMAZ in GolfGTI

[–]TheNotoriousMAZ[S] 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Funny you should ask. I just put the Generals back on a few weeks ago after rocking my winter wheels. They are still fantastic tires and make the car much better to drive. The tires wore very evenly as well.

This is last summer that I’ll get out of them before they need to be replaced. At the end of the day, they were good for about 30K-35K miles.

I haven’t paid much attention to the tire market the past few years, but I’ll definitely be considering them again when I replace. If they’re still well priced compared to the competition, you wont be disappointed. They’re excellent tires.
